Разработка в codespace - как использовать GitHub Enterprise Cloud

Разработка в codespace - как использовать GitHub Enterprise Cloud
На чтение
24 мин.
Просмотров
18
Дата обновления
26.02.2025
#COURSE##INNER#

GitHub Enterprise Cloud - это инструмент для разработчиков, предоставляющий все необходимые средства для автоматизации и упрощения работы над проектами. С его помощью разработчикам удается создавать, отслеживать и совместно работать над кодом, а также управлять задачами и внесенными изменениями.

В codespace предоставляется широкий набор функций и инструментов, включая систему контроля версий Git, возможность создания модулей и пакетов, интегрированные средства разработки и многое другое. Каждый разработчик может выбрать нужные инструменты и настроить их под себя.

Одна из важных особенностей GitHub Enterprise Cloud - это возможность работы в команде. Разработчики могут совместно работать над одним проектом, делиться кодом и комментировать изменения. Это позволяет более эффективно выполнять задачи и повышает качество кода благодаря совместному кодированию и обмену опытом.

Подготовка к разработке в codespace

Перед тем, как приступить к разработке в codespace, вам понадобится выполнить несколько предварительных шагов. В этом разделе мы рассмотрим основные этапы подготовки.

Шаг 1: Создание аккаунта на GitHub

Если у вас еще нет аккаунта на GitHub, вам необходимо создать его. Для этого перейдите на официальный сайт GitHub, нажмите кнопку "Sign up" и заполните необходимые данные.

Примечание: Вы можете использовать свой существующий аккаунт GitHub, если таковой имеется.

Шаг 2: Подключение codespace к репозиторию

Далее вам нужно подключить codespace к вашему репозиторию на GitHub. Для этого откройте страницу вашего репозитория, нажмите кнопку "Codes" и выберите опцию "Open with codespace".

Шаг 3: Настройка codespace

После подключения codespace к репозиторию, вам потребуется выполнить некоторые настройки. Определите список необходимых зависимостей и скриптов, а также настройте окружение разработки в соответствии с вашими требованиями.

Примечание: Хорошей практикой является настройка файлов .devcontainer и .vscode в репозитории, чтобы кодспейс автоматически настраивался для всех разработчиков.

Шаг 4: Запуск codespace

И наконец, когда все настройки выполнены, вы можете запустить codespace и начать разработку. Откройте репозиторий на GitHub, выберите codespace из списка опций и нажмите кнопку "Open".

Теперь вы готовы к разработке в codespace! Удачной работы!

Настройка рабочего окружения

Перед началом работы с codespace в GitHub Enterprise Cloud необходимо настроить рабочее окружение, чтобы обеспечить эффективную разработку и совместную работу.

Основные шаги для настройки рабочего окружения:

  1. Установка Git: Сначала установите Git - распределённую систему управления версиями, которая является основой для работы с GitHub. Вы можете скачать и установить Git с официального сайта.
  2. Создание учетной записи GitHub: Если у вас еще нет учетной записи на GitHub, создайте ее на их сайте. Учетная запись GitHub позволяет вам создавать и хранить репозитории для вашего кода, а также работать с другими разработчиками.
  3. Настройка SSH-ключа: Для безопасной коммуникации с удаленными репозиториями на GitHub вам потребуется настроить SSH-ключ. Это обеспечит безопасную аутентификацию и защитит ваш код от несанкционированного доступа.
  4. Настройка окружения codespace: Чтобы настроить codespace, перейдите во вкладку Codespaces в репозитории, которые вы хотите разрабатывать. Нажмите кнопку "New codespace" и выберите конфигурацию, которую вы хотите использовать. Вы также можете настроить дополнительные параметры, такие как размер и ресурсы codespace.

После выполнения этих шагов вы будете готовы начать разработку в codespace на GitHub Enterprise Cloud. Это предоставит вам полноценную среду разработки, где вы сможете создавать, тестировать и совместно работать над своим кодом с другими разработчиками.

Обратите внимание, что настройка рабочего окружения может отличаться в зависимости от вашей операционной системы и индивидуальных настроек.

Установка и настройка codespace

  1. Зарегистрироваться в GitHub и войти в свою учетную запись.
  2. Открыть репозиторий, в котором вы хотите настроить codespace.
  3. Нажать на кнопку "Code" над списком файлов в репозитории.
  4. Выбрать "Open with Codespaces" в выпадающем меню.

После этого Codespace автоматически создаст для вас виртуальную среду, готовую к работе. Вы сможете выполнять команды в терминале, редактировать файлы и запускать свои приложения, все внутри браузера.

Кроме того, вы можете настроить Codespace под свои нужды. Для этого перейдите в настройки вашего репозитория и выберите "Codespaces" в боковом меню. Здесь вы можете настроить параметры среды разработки, такие как выбор операционной системы, подключение к базе данных и другие.

Таким образом, установка и настройка codespace являются простыми шагами, которые позволяют вам быстро начать работу над проектом прямо в браузере с помощью GitHub и Codespace.

Импорт проекта в codespace

Codespaces позволяет разработчикам импортировать существующие проекты с GitHub и начать работать над ними прямо в облаке. В этом разделе мы рассмотрим, как выполнить импорт проекта в codespace.

Чтобы импортировать проект в codespace, выполните следующие шаги:

  1. Откройте страницу codespace в вашем аккаунте GitHub Enterprise Cloud.
  2. На странице codespace нажмите кнопку «New codespace».
  3. В разделе «Import a repository» выберите проект, который вы хотите импортировать.
  4. Нажмите кнопку «Create codespace».

После завершения импорта проекта в codespace, вы сможете начать работать над ним прямо в браузере, используя все возможности, предоставляемые codespaces. Вы сможете редактировать код, запускать тесты, выполнять отладку и многое другое прямо в облаке.

Важно отметить, что codespaces обеспечивает среду разработки, полностью изолированную от вашей локальной системы. Это позволяет вам работать над проектом в любом месте, на любом устройстве, имея доступ к тому же набору инструментов, что и на вашем рабочем компьютере.

Импортирование проекта в codespace - это простой и удобный способ начать работу над проектом прямо в облаке. Он устраняет необходимость установки и настройки локальной среды разработки и позволяет сосредоточиться на создании кода.

Работа с GitHub Enterprise Cloud в codespace

Codespace - это виртуальное среда разработки, основанная на облаке, которая предоставляется GitHub. Он включает в себя всю необходимую инфраструктуру для работы с вашими репозиториями, включая кодовое хранилище, среду программирования и запуск приложений.

Работа с GitHub Enterprise Cloud в codespace позволяет вам работать удаленно над вашим проектом, что позволяет вам обмениваться кодом с другими разработчиками и получать обновления в реальном времени. Также вы можете легко переключаться между различными проектами и командами, не теряя ни времени, ни контекста.

С помощью codespace вы можете использовать все основные функции GitHub, такие как управление задачами, обзор кода и совместное редактирование, а также добавить дополнительные инструменты и расширения для оптимизации процесса разработки.

GitHub Enterprise Cloud в codespace - это идеальный выбор для команд разработчиков, которые хотят иметь все необходимое для работы с GitHub в удобной виртуальной среде разработки.

Создание нового репозитория

Чтобы создать новый репозиторий в GitHub Enterprise Cloud, выполните следующие шаги:

  1. Откройте страницу своего аккаунта на GitHub Enterprise Cloud.
  2. В правом верхнем углу страницы нажмите кнопку "New".
  3. Выберите опцию "New repository" из выпадающего меню.
  4. Введите имя для вашего нового репозитория в поле "Repository name".
  5. Добавьте описание (необязательно) для вашего репозитория в поле "Description".
  6. Выберите доступность вашего репозитория (публичный или приватный) с помощью радиокнопок.
  7. Выберите лицензию репозитория, если это необходимо.
  8. Добавьте .gitignore файл, если это необходимо, выбрав соответствующую опцию из списка.
  9. Добавьте файл "README.md", если это необходимо, выбрав соответствующую опцию из списка.
  10. Нажмите кнопку "Create repository" для создания нового репозитория.

После успешного создания репозитория вы будете перенаправлены на его страницу, где вы сможете приступить к работе с вашим новым репозиторием на GitHub Enterprise Cloud.

Клонирование репозитория

Клонирование репозитория позволяет создать точную копию удаленного репозитория на вашем локальном компьютере. Клонирование не только копирует файлы, но и создает локальную связь с удаленным репозиторием, которую можно использовать для синхронизации изменений.

Для клонирования репозитория в Codespace выполните следующие шаги:

  1. Откройте репозиторий, который вы хотите клонировать, в Codespace.
  2. Щелкните на кнопке "Clone" (Клонировать) в правом верхнем углу экрана. Это откроет окно "Clone repository" (Клонировать репозиторий).
  3. Скопируйте URL-адрес удаленного репозитория.
  4. Откройте терминал в Codespace, нажав на кнопку "Terminal" (Терминал) внизу экрана.
  5. Введите команду "git clone" и вставьте скопированный URL-адрес репозитория.
  6. Нажмите Enter, чтобы выполнить команду клонирования.

Теперь у вас есть локальная копия удаленного репозитория на вашем компьютере. Это позволяет вам вносить изменения в код, коммитить и пушить их обратно в удаленный репозиторий.

Клонирование репозитория - это первый шаг в работе с кодом в Codespace. После клонирования вы можете открыть исходные файлы, вносить изменения, запускать приложение, и многое другое.

Вопрос-ответ:

Что такое codespaces?

Codespaces - это среда разработки, которую можно создать непосредственно в GitHub. Она позволяет быстро настроить и запустить виртуальную машину, где разработчики могут писать и тестировать свой код.

Каковы преимущества использования codespaces?

Использование codespaces позволяет разработчикам быстро получить рабочую среду для работы над проектом без необходимости настройки и установки средств разработки на своем компьютере. Также codespaces легко масштабируемы и обеспечивают удобный доступ к Git-репозиториям.

Какие возможности предоставляет codespaces для разработчиков?

Codespaces предоставляет возможность работать с Git-репозиториями, открывать файлы, делать коммиты, запускать тесты и т.д. Вся работа осуществляется в виртуальной машине, что позволяет изолировать рабочую среду и не влиять на локальную систему разработчика.

Что такое GitHub Enterprise Cloud?

GitHub Enterprise Cloud - это облачное решение для размещения и управления Git-репозиториями, предоставляемое компанией GitHub. Это позволяет организациям и командам разработчиков управлять своими проектами и сдер`живаться находится в облачном хранилище.

Могу ли я использовать codespaces с GitHub Enterprise Cloud?

Да, codespaces можно использовать с GitHub Enterprise Cloud. В этом случае вам необходимо подключить ваш аккаунт GitHub Enterprise Cloud с Codespaces, чтобы получить доступ к вашим репозиториям и настроить рабочую среду в кодероне.

Как разрабатывать в codespace?

Для разработки в codespace необходимо сначала создать новый codespace, перейдя на страницу репозитория на GitHub и нажав на кнопку "Code". Затем нужно выбрать "Open with codespaces" и в новом окне выбрать "New codespace". После этого можно начинать разработку, используя различные инструменты и функции, которые предоставляет codespace.

Как создать новый codespace на GitHub Enterprise Cloud?

Для создания нового codespace на GitHub Enterprise Cloud нужно перейти на страницу репозитория и нажать на кнопку "Code". Затем следует выбрать "Open with codespaces" и в новом окне выбрать "New codespace". После этого codespace будет создан и можно приступать к разработке.

Видео:

GitHub Codespaces: Everything you need to know

GitHub Codespaces: Everything you need to know by GitHub 1,843 views Streamed 5 months ago 1 hour

Build faster with GitHub Copilot and Codespaces

Build faster with GitHub Copilot and Codespaces by Microsoft Developer 1,074 views 2 months ago 15 minutes

0 Комментариев
Комментариев на модерации: 0
Оставьте комментарий